+//! Template source resolution for `proj-init`.
+//!
+//! A template source is either:
+//! - a git remote template addressed as `<ref>@<variant>` (e.g. `0.4@basic`),
+//! where `ref` is a tag, branch or commit hash and `variant` is a
+//! subdirectory of the repository;
+//! - a local template directory given by a plain path.
+
+use std::{
+ fs,
+ path::{Path, PathBuf},
+ process::Command,
+};
+
+use mingling::picker::{PickerArgResult, SinglePickable};
+
+/// Default template source when none is configured: the `mingling-rs/tmpl`
+/// repository on GitHub.
+pub const DEFAULT_TMPL_SOURCE: &str = "mingling-rs/tmpl";
+
+/// The template cache root: `~/.local/share/mingling/cache`.
+pub fn cache_dir() -> PathBuf {
+ dirs::data_local_dir()
+ .unwrap_or_default()
+ .join("mingling")
+ .join("cache")
+}
+
+/// Normalize a template source spec into a full git URL.
+///
+/// - `mingling-rs/tmpl` -> `https://github.com/mingling-rs/tmpl.git`
+/// - `https://github.com/mingling-rs/tmpl` -> `https://github.com/mingling-rs/tmpl.git`
+/// - `https://example.com/tmpl.git` -> unchanged
+pub fn normalize_source(source: &str) -> String {
+ if source.ends_with(".git") {
+ return source.to_string();
+ }
+ if source.contains("://") {
+ // Ensure GitHub URLs share the same cache key as the short form.
+ if let Some(rest) = source.strip_prefix("https://github.com/") {
+ return format!("https://github.com/{rest}.git");
+ }
+ return source.to_string();
+ }
+ if let Some((owner, repo)) = source.split_once('/') {
+ return format!("https://github.com/{owner}/{repo}.git");
+ }
+ source.to_string()
+}

+/// Resolve a git template source to a local template directory.
+///
+/// The repository is shallow-cloned into
+/// `<cache>/<source-hash>/<ref-hash>/` where `<source-hash>` is the first 16
+/// hex chars of the SHA-256 of the source URL and `<ref-hash>` is the first 16
+/// hex chars of the resolved commit. Already-cached references are reused. The
+/// returned path is `<repo>/<variant>`, validated to contain a `checklist.toml`.
+pub fn resolve_git(
+ source_url: &str,
+ reference: &str,
+ variant: &str,
+ cache: &Path,
+) -> Result<PathBuf, String> {
+ let source_hash = sha256_prefix16(source_url);
+ let full_hash = resolve_commit(source_url, reference)?;
+ let ref_hash = &full_hash[..16];
+ let repo_dir = cache.join(source_hash).join(ref_hash);
+
+ if !repo_dir.join(".git").is_dir() {
+ shallow_clone(source_url, reference, &full_hash, &repo_dir)?;
+ }
+
+ let template_dir = repo_dir.join(variant);
+ if !template_dir.join("checklist.toml").is_file() {
+ return Err(format!(
+ "variant `{variant}` has no checklist.toml in repository {source_url}"
+ ));
+ }
+ Ok(template_dir)
+}
+
+/// First 16 hex chars of the SHA-256 digest of `input`.
+fn sha256_prefix16(input: &str) -> String {
+ use sha2::{Digest, Sha256};
+ let mut hasher = Sha256::new();
+ hasher.update(input.as_bytes());
+ let digest = hasher.finalize();
+ digest.iter().take(8).map(|b| format!("{b:02x}")).collect()
+}
+
+/// Resolve `reference` (tag / branch / commit hash) to its full commit hash.
+///
+/// A full 40-hex reference is used as-is; otherwise `git ls-remote` resolves
+/// it — first as a ref name (tag / branch), then by prefix-matching against
+/// every advertised ref to support abbreviated commit hashes.
+fn resolve_commit(source_url: &str, reference: &str) -> Result<String, String> {
+ if reference.len() == 40 && reference.chars().all(|c| c.is_ascii_hexdigit()) {
+ return Ok(reference.to_string());
+ }
+
+ // Ref name resolution (tag / branch).
+ let by_ref = git_ls_remote(source_url, Some(reference))?;
+ if let Some(hash) = by_ref
+ .lines()
+ .next()
+ .and_then(|line| line.split('\t').next())
+ {
+ return Ok(hash.to_string());
+ }
+
+ // Abbreviated commit hash: prefix-match against all advertised refs.
+ let all_refs = git_ls_remote(source_url, None)?;
+ for line in all_refs.lines() {
+ let Some(hash) = line.split('\t').next() else {
+ continue;
+ };
+ if hash.starts_with(reference) {
+ return Ok(hash.to_string());
+ }
+ }
+
+ Err(format!("reference `{reference}` not found in {source_url}"))
+}
+
+/// Run `git ls-remote <url> [pattern]` and return its stdout.
+fn git_ls_remote(source_url: &str, pattern: Option<&str>) -> Result<String, String> {
+ let mut cmd = Command::new("git");
+ cmd.args(["ls-remote", source_url]);
+ if let Some(pattern) = pattern {
+ cmd.arg(pattern);
+ }
+ let output = cmd
+ .output()
+ .map_err(|e| format!("failed to run `git ls-remote`: {e}"))?;
+ if !output.status.success() {
+ return Err(String::from_utf8_lossy(&output.stderr).trim().to_string());
+ }
+ Ok(String::from_utf8_lossy(&output.stdout).into_owned())
+}
+
+/// Shallow-clone `reference` from `source_url` into `dst`.
+///
+/// Uses `git init` + `git fetch --depth 1 origin <reference>` so that tags and
+/// branches are handled uniformly. When the reference is not a ref name (a
+/// commit hash), it falls back to fetching the resolved full hash — supported
+/// by GitHub, but not by plain local `file://` protocols.
+fn shallow_clone(
+ source_url: &str,
+ reference: &str,
+ full_hash: &str,
+ dst: &Path,
+) -> Result<(), String> {
+ if dst.exists() {
+ fs::remove_dir_all(dst).map_err(|e| e.to_string())?;
+ }
+ fs::create_dir_all(dst).map_err(|e| e.to_string())?;
+
+ run_git(dst, ["init", "-q"])?;
+ run_git(dst, ["remote", "add", "origin", source_url])?;
+
+ let fetched_by_ref = run_git(dst, ["fetch", "-q", "--depth", "1", "origin", reference]);
+ if fetched_by_ref.is_err() {
+ run_git(dst, ["fetch", "-q", "--depth", "1", "origin", full_hash])?;
+ }
+
+ // `git fetch` only writes FETCH_HEAD; the fresh repo has no branch yet, so
+ // create one explicitly to populate the working tree.
+ run_git(dst, ["checkout", "-q", "-B", "cache", "FETCH_HEAD"])?;
+ Ok(())
+}
+
+/// Run a git command in `cwd`, returning an error message on failure.
+fn run_git<const N: usize>(cwd: &Path, args: [&str; N]) -> Result<(), String> {
+ let status = Command::new("git")
+ .args(args)
+ .current_dir(cwd)
+ .status()
+ .map_err(|e| format!("failed to run git: {e}"))?;
+ if !status.success() {
+ return Err(format!("git command failed with {status}"));
+ }
+ Ok(())
+}
